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
Tags
- 리액트
- 자바
- HTML
- 핀토스
- CSS
- 크래프톤 정글
- defee
- 백준
- 스택
- 시스템콜
- 티스토리챌린지
- 4기
- 크래프톤정글
- userprog
- 자바스크립트
- 모션비트
- 코드트리
- 나만무
- corou
- JavaScript
- 사이드프로젝트
- 오블완
- pintos
- TiL
- Vue.js
- 소켓
- 큐
- Java
- Flutter
- 알고리즘
Archives
- Today
- Total
목록Redux (1)
미새문지
24.07.31 day37 리덕스를 사용하는 이유, 리덕스의 3대 원칙, 내려가기
리덕스를 사용하는 이유리덕스를 사용하는 이유는 주로 애플리케이션의 상태 관리가 복잡해지면서 나타나는 문제들을 해결하기 위함이다.리덕스의 장점예측 가능한 상태 관리리덕스는 단일 스토어와 액션, 리듀서를 사용하여 상태 변경이 언제 어디서 일어나는지 명확하게 정의할 수 있다.이를 통해 상태 변화의 흐름을 쉽게 추적하고 예측할 수 있다.디버깅 및 개발 도구 지원리덕스는 강력한 디버깅 도구인 Redux DevTools를 제공하는데, 이 도구를 사용하면 상태 변경을 시각화하고, 시간 여행 디버깅(time-travel debugging)을 통해 이전 상태로 돌아가거나 특정 시점의 상태를 재현할 수 있다.중앙 집중식 상태 관리애플리케이션의 모든 상태가 하나의 스토어에 저장되므로 상태 관리가 중앙집중식으로 이루어지며, ..
개발 TIL
2024. 7. 31. 23:02